👵🏻👨🏻🦳💍 В России предложили платить за долгий брак — законопроект внесут в Госдуму
За 30 лет совместной жизни супруги смогут получить 30 тысяч рублей, за 40 лет — 40 тысяч, за 50 лет — 50 тысяч, за 60 лет — 60 тысяч и 70 тысяч рублей за 70 лет.
Если инициативу одобрят, то закон вступит в силу с 1 января 2026 года
